Overview of Cisco Catalyst 8510 Route Processor Module 

The Cisco C8510-SRP Catalyst 8510 Route Processor Switch is engineered as a high-capacity control and routing module tailored for enterprise-grade campus backbones. Built by Cisco Systems, Inc., this plug-in route processor delivers intelligent Layer 3 switching functionality while integrating seamlessly into the Catalyst 8510 architecture. Designed to manage complex routing tables and traffic flows, this module acts as the logical core of large-scale network infrastructures where resilience, scalability, and centralized control are essential.

Product Identity and Classification

  • Manufacturer: Cisco  
  • Brand Lineage: Cisco Catalyst Series
  • Part Number: C8510-SRP
  • Device Type: Route Processor Switch
  • Form Factor: Internal plug-in route processor
  • Primary Function: Advanced Layer 3 traffic control

Dynamic and Static Routing Capabilities

  • Open Shortest Path First for scalable internal routing
  • Border Gateway Protocol version 4 for external path control
  • Interior Gateway Routing Protocol and Enhanced IGRP
  • Routing Information Protocol versions 1 and 2
  • Static IP routing for deterministic path selection

Multicast and High Availability Protocols

  • Internet Group Management Protocol and IGMPv2
  • Hot Standby Router Protocol for gateway redundancy

Remote Administration Protocols

  • Simple Network Management Protocol for real-time visibility
  • Remote Monitoring for traffic analysis and alerts
  • Telnet access for command-line configuration

Authentication and Data Integrity

  • MD5-based encryption for message integrity
  • RADIUS authentication for centralized user control
  • TACACS+ for granular administrative authorization

Core Hardware Specifications

  • Single R4600 processor operating at 100 MHz
  • 256 MB of system RAM for routing tables and processes
  • 16 MB of flash storage for firmware and configuration data

Status and Diagnostic Indicators

  • Link integrity confirmation
  • Overall system status indication
  • Transmit activity monitoring
  • Receive activity monitoring

Connectivity Options and Expansion Potential

  • 10Base-T RJ-45 Ethernet port for management access
  • DB-25 console interface for direct system control
  • DB-25 auxiliary port for external device connectivity
  • Single expansion slot for modular upgrades

Operational Tolerances

  • Minimum operating temperature of 32 degrees Fahrenheit
  • Maximum operating temperature of 122 degrees Fahrenheit
  • Supported humidity range from 10 to 90 percent

Separation of Control and Forwarding Planes

The Cisco C8510-SRP leverages a clear separation between the control plane and the data forwarding plane. This architectural principle enhances scalability by allowing forwarding engines to process packets at line rate while the route processor focuses on decision-making and policy application. Such separation reduces contention for resources and improves overall system stability.

In high-demand environments, this design ensures that control plane operations remain unaffected by spikes in data traffic. The result is predictable routing behavior, faster convergence times, and improved network reliability.
